kd2777 07-08-2008 09:15 PM

I used to run the JP B5 mod. I loved it. I always ran the MSR 1005 on it. I had the GRP .28 and liked the 1005 on it as well, also the GRP 2053, but the 1005 was better. I had the Hott Mod 528 and the RB 928, I ran the JP2 on them. There may have been a better pipe out there, but when they cam up on pipe it was ll I could do to hold on.
